Gov. Schwarzenegger’s Foreclosure Moratorium Explained

February 25, 2009

Gov. Arnold Schwarzenegger signed a 90-day moratorium on California home foreclosures (legislation SB2X-7 and AB2X-7) amid criticism that the law likely won’t put a dent in the skyrocketing pace of repossessions.

Foreclosure Inventory Skyrockets, Home Prices Hit Historic Low

January 23, 2009

Here’s a quick, informative slice of what’s happening in the booming buyer’s market this week:
1. Foreclosures are at an all-time high nationwide.
